Cardia cancer is a special type of gastric cancer, so experts remind everyone not to ignore cardia cancer. Pain is one of the common symptoms of cardia cancer. So, what is the cause of pain in cardia cancer ? In response to this question, let the experts give you a detailed introduction to the causes of pain in cardia cancer. 1. Causes of pain in cardiac cancer: pain caused by the growth of cardiac cancer The growth of cardia cancer has a great impact on the body, which is very different from benign tumors. Benign tumors develop in an expansive manner, so the obstruction and tenderness to local tissues and organs are more obvious. Cardiac cancer mainly develops in an invasive manner, and its tissue cells are different from normal tissues in morphological structure, functional metabolism, biochemical changes and enzymology. It also invades adjacent tissues and organs, destroys tissue structure, and changes its function. The worse the differentiation, the faster the growth. The blood supply to the tumor is relatively reduced, and central necrosis, swelling, exudation and combined infection of the tumor are prone to occur. If the nerves and blood vessels in the area of cardia cancer are involved, cancer pain may occur; if tumor cells invade nerves or tumors compress nerves, severe pain may occur; if tumor cells invade blood vessels, vascular blood supply disorders may occur and pain may occur. The growth of cardia cancer causes capsule expansion and compression, or rupture and bleeding stimulate the pleura and peritoneum to cause pain. Fear aggravates the patient's pain Cardiac cancer is a difficult disease to treat. Cancer pain is the most severe chronic pain. Cardiac cancer patients are very afraid of it. At the same time, patients will receive adverse stimulation throughout the course of the disease. The causes of cardiac cancer pain, such as harmful diagnosis, physical decline, loss of work and living ability, medical condition restrictions, misunderstanding and even discrimination from others and units, can all lead to psychological changes in patients, causing depression and anxiety, aggravating the deterioration of the whole body, and causing a vicious cycle. This leads to an increase in the brain's sensitivity to pain stimulation and a decrease in pain threshold, aggravating the patient's pain. 3. Pain caused by the spread of cardia cancer Cardiac cancer can infiltrate adjacent tissues and organs at the primary site and cause pain in cardiac cancer because it can also metastasize (or spread) to other parts of the body other than the primary site through other pathways (such as the vascular system, lymphatic system, detached implants, etc.). If the tumor invades and compresses blood vessels, nerves, and organs, not only will the functions of the corresponding tissues and organs change, but pain will also occur. Cardiac cancer may even compress nerves and adjacent bone tissues and cause pathological fractures. Cancer cells invade viscera and blood vessels, causing arterial occlusion, venous bleeding, and visceral cavity obstruction, squeezing and stimulating the nerve receptors in the visceral capsule, chest, abdomen, and vascular wall, causing pain in the corresponding parts. 4. Substances produced by cancer cells cause pain Some cardiac cancers produce hormone-like chemicals, metabolites of tumor cells, decomposition products of necrotic tissue, and toxins produced by secondary infections after reduced disease resistance, which can all activate and sensitize pressure receptors and chemical receptors, causing physiological and pathological changes in nerves and pain. In addition, the above factors also increase the body's consumption and cause fever, so that the patient eventually develops severe anemia, weight loss, metabolic disorders, and develops cachexia, which aggravates the pain.
